Drinking Etiquette and Cultural Insights

Local Bar Hopping in Tokyo: Away From the Tourist Traps - Drinking Etiquette and Cultural Insights

As participants venture into Tokyo’s vibrant nightlife, the tour guide provides insights into Japanese drinking etiquette and cultural nuances.

They learn that pouring drinks for others is a sign of respect, and it’s considered impolite to pour your own. Clinking glasses is also avoided, as it’s seen as a remnant of Western influences.

The guide explains the importance of moderation and never drinking to the point of intoxication, which is frowned upon.

These cultural lessons enhance the experience, allowing guests to navigate the local bar scene with a deeper understanding of Japanese customs.

Recommendations and Requirements

Local Bar Hopping in Tokyo: Away From the Tourist Traps - Recommendations and Requirements

The tour has a few essential requirements for participants. Guests must be at least 20 years old, as the legal drinking age in Japan is 20.

Pregnant women and those with mobility issues won’t be able to participate fully. The tour isn’t suitable for children under 18 or wheelchair users.

Guests should wear comfortable shoes and bring a camera to capture the vibrant nightlife.

The tour includes transportation to and from the meeting point, but visitors should also budget 5,000-10,000 yen for additional drinks at other bars. Tips for bartenders aren’t included in the tour price.
